2 Ducats - Christian V ND
1675 year| Gold (.979) | 6.981 g | 17.25 mm |
| Issuer | Denmark |
|---|---|
| King | Christian V (1670-1699) |
| Type | Standard circulation coin |
| Year | 1675 |
| Value | 2 Ducats (2 Dukater) (4) |
| Currency | Rigsdaler specie (1625-1813) |
| Composition | Gold (.979) |
| Weight | 6.981 g |
| Diameter | 17.25 mm |
| Shape | Round |
| Demonetized | Yes |
| Updated | 2024-10-04 |
| Numista | N#112500 |

Reverse
Crowned double King's monogram
Lettering: 5CC5
Comment
Size of this coin is as a half dukat, but planchet is four times thicker.Interesting fact
